To assess the weight of wood, you’ll need to specify if it’s treated or untreated as pressure-treated lumber tends to be slightly heavier. Lumber treated for ground contact has 0.15 pounds per cubic foot chemical retention compared to standard treated wood’s 0.06 pounds/cubic foot. If you know the board footage of the lumber, divide it by 12 to find the volume in cubic feet. Our board footage calculator can help find the volume of your wood in board feet. You can also calculate the volume of lumber by measuring the length, width, and thickness in inches and multiplying them together. This will get the volume in cubic inches.

Dry concrete weighs around 3,400 to 3,600 pounds per cubic yard.Jan 16, 2022 · On average a 2×12 board made from standard construction lumber will weigh approximately 38 pounds. However it’s important to note that the weight of a 2×12 board can vary depending on the wood species from which it is made. For example a 2×12 board made from cedar will weigh slightly less than one made from pine.
